Quote:
Originally Posted by ilmatic View Post
anyone beat the skyline seasonal event yet? im using a r34 and i can only come up with second
here's my setup with an '09 spec V:

Transmission:
Max Speed: 280 kph

Downforce:
2/22

Drivetrain: (front/rear)
Initial Torque: 5/13
Acceleration: 20/45
Deceleration: 10/20
Torque Split: 25/75

Suspension: (front/rear)
Ride Height: -20/-20
Spring Rates (kgf/mm): 15.2/10.0
Dampers Extension: 6/6
Dampers Compression: 6/6
Anti-Roll Bars: 4/4
Camber: 2.2/1.5
Toe: +0.18/-0.10

Brake Balance (front/rear): 6/5

Quote:
Originally Posted by TOS'd View Post
And how does one "dupe" a car?
back up save game to a usb stick
gift car to friend
delete save game
restore save game from usb stick

now both of you will have the car
